最近开始学习Windows server,大概了解了活动目录,个人觉得看书看资料只是一个辅助,最重要的还是自己动手做,自己总结。

     下面是做了一个域迁移(从2003到2008)的步骤,以及遇到的问题和解决办法。在此记录下来,以供日后参考。

 

      实验环境两台虚拟机Windows server2003和Windows server2008,其中Windows server2003为域控,Windows server2008需要加入域。

             1.需要扩展2003域控制器的林、域、策略、只读域控,这时要用到adprep这个工具,将Windows server2008的光盘里的\support\adprep文件复制到Windows server2003虚拟机的硬盘上,然后在命令行里分别使用 adprep /forestprep , adprep /domainprep , adprep /domainprep /gpprep , adprep /rodcprep进行扩展。

 

 

 

出现上述“not in native mode”错误,说明2003的域控是在2000级别,需要提升域控制器的域功能级别和林功能级别。解决如下:

 

 

 

 

 

        2.下面就需要将Windows server2008从域成员提升为域控制器,即使用 dcpromo命令安装DC,在此需要以域账户登陆Windows server2008。

        3.最后需要把域控制器的五大角色从Windows server2003上传送过来。

有两种方法:

其一,用ntdsutil工具

 

 

 

在那Windows server2008上查看fsmo,已经迁移过来。 

至此迁移完毕!

其二,用图形化界面

 

 

 

 

通过以上4步传送过来4个角色,还剩下架构主机,输入 regsvr32 schmmgmt 命令在mmc中注册该组件

 

 

 

 

 

 

 

 

 

 

至此,域迁移完成!

欢迎批评指正!